Release checklist — shared component library (Lanternkit): confirm the version bump follows semver and that the changelog lists every breaking prop rename, since support gets tickets whenever consuming teams upgrade blind. Verify the deprecation warnings fire in the demo app and that the migration guide link resolves. Once QA signs off, tag the release and log it. The associated build identifier appears below.

build token for kagaf-hahof: htk14_9d3d4d26d7d8de

Handover: EXIF scrubbing (Pellmark uploads)

Scrubber runs in the Graywing worker pool, stripping GPS and serial tags before images hit storage. Known gaps: HEIC sidecar files aren't scrubbed yet (ticketed), and the retry path can skip scrubbing if the worker dies mid-job — check the reconciliation job daily until that's fixed. Don't trust the "scrubbed" flag alone; verify with the sampler. Architecture notes and the tag allowlist are on the internal page below.

operations page: https://jenkins.zemvarcloud.local/job/merge_requests/repo/build/73930b4b30f0a8ed

## Local setup

To reproduce the Fanfare notification backpressure locally, you'll want the fan-out worker plus a throttled consumer so the queue actually fills up. Run `make fanfare-local` to bring up the worker, then start the slow consumer with `--delay 500ms`. Backpressure kicks in once the pending table passes 10k rows, which takes about two minutes. The worker reads its pending queue from the local database using the connection string below.

replica DSN, kajep-yahag: mssql://praok_svc:iF@db-8d68.plorvaio.local:5432/eliion

### Ticket-pricing experiment: Gatefold v2

We're testing demand-based price steps on Gatefold's matinee inventory. Treatment arm gets dynamic steps; control keeps flat pricing. Guardrails: no step exceeds the cap, and prices freeze 48h before showtime. Metrics land in the Ledgerline warehouse hourly. Ramp stays at 10% until the sync reviews week-one results. Experiment knobs are defined below.

limits module of fajog-tawig:
RATE_LIMITS = {
    "druwyn": 2,
    "quenael": 10,
    "wenix": 2,
    "druael": 2,
}